Definition of Indefinite Articles in English Grammar with Examples

Introduction

Indefinite article is the exact opposite of definite article. Definite article points out a particular person or thing, whereas indefinite article does not refer to any particular person or thing of a group. Rather indefinite article is used to refer nonspecific noun that can be anything or anyone out of a group. 

In English grammar ‘a’ and ‘an’ are known as indefinite article. Indefinite article can only be used before singular countable nouns. 

Examples

  • He ate an apple. 
  • You should consult with a doctor. 
  • Are some suffering from a chronic illness? 
  • I took a short nap after working for hours. 
  • I will reach home in an hour. 
  • We were having an interesting discussion.
  • This is a serious matter. 
  • A tiger can run 40 miles per hour. 
  • She is a citizen of India. 
  • I want to pursue my M.A from a good university.
